ArcGis+Sql express 2008 r2 проблемы с версиями

0 голосов
спросил 08 Авг, 13 от Erkin.Mukhamedkulov (340 баллов) в категории Программные продукты Esri
Уважаемые знатоки, доброго времени суток.
Итак в наличии: ArcGis Desctop editor 10.1 - 3 штук, Windows server 2008 Enterprise - 1 штук, Sql Server Express 2008 r2 на это сервере 1 штук.
Преамбула :
- 2 локальные машины подключены по Wi-fi к роутеру, одна по Ethernet пинг проходит во все стороны, сетевых проблем нет, базы открываются.
- Установка Sql Express из папки Sde в установочном ArcGisDesctop прошла успешно, текстовый поиск включён
- Подключение к ней из ArcCatalog на машинах в сети проходит удачно, учётные записи домена цепляются, все три машины с правами администратора.
- Создание Корпоративной базы данных из набора системных инструментов проходит успешно.
- При созданий корпоративной базы данных создаётся схема .DBO (не знаю почему он не даёт создавать Sde но видимо так уж в Expresse положено)
- После подгружаю в эту базу данных свой наборы данных с пространственной привязкой (успешно)
- Регистрирую набор данных как версионные (так же из инструментария Data Managment-Version)
- Создаю версий под родительской версией DBO.default с открытым доступом и без блокировок
- Переподсоединяюсь к базе с указанием версии (в контекстном меню)
- В настройках редактора включаю версионное редактирование, выбираю редакцию обьектов в версии DBO
Проблема :
на одной из машин, при подгрузке инфы происходит следующее : инфа вносимая в базу с других машин ей не видна, а вот другие машины её инфу видят.
Пробовал сносить коннект и соединятся заново, создавать дочернюю версию под родительской и вносить изменения глючащего компа в неё а после соединять версии, пробовал начинать и собирать проект на месте заново и заливать инфу с это машины, администрировать с этой машины, устанавливать версионные наборы пространственных обьектов с этой машины, танцевать с бубном, пить йаду и курить мануалы. Ничего не выходит, две машины в сети работают нормально, а третья только вносит изменения но не видит изменения других.
-

2 Ответы

0 голосов
ответил 09 Авг, 13 от Grigoriy (127,020 баллов)
Если Вы редактируете одну и ту же версию несколькими пользователями, то согласование конфликтов будет происходить автоматическив момент сохранения. Чтобы увидеть последние изменения, сделанные соседом, возможно нужно просто обновить карту.
Делается это кнопочкой Refresh (Обновить) на панели инструментов "Версии" (Versioning).
http://esri-cis.ru/download/public/Forum/version_refresh.jpg
Если же Вы редактируете разные версии, то изменения в родительской версии появятся только после согласования и закрепления изменений из дочерней версии в родительскую.
Версионное редактирование
Использование команды Изменение версии
Введение в согласование версий
0 голосов
ответил 12 Авг, 13 от Erkin.Mukhamedkulov (340 баллов)
Итак проблема решилась удалением дочерних версий и установкой версионного редактирования для всех пользователей от версии DBO.Default.
Всем спасибо за внимание, тему можно закрывать.
Добро пожаловать на сайт Вопросов и Ответов, где вы можете задавать вопросы по GIS тематике и получать ответы от других членов сообщества.
...